Mangrove ecosystems are very important in the balance of ecosystems in coastal areas, because many mangrove functions cannot be replaced by other ecosystems or vegetation from physical, ecological to economic functions. The mangrove ecosystem is decreasing along with the development of coastal areas construction, reclamation, and natural factors including coastal abrasion. This study aims to evaluate emerge land for the mangrove rehabilitation conservation program in Kaliwlingi, Brebes Regency. The imagery used is Landsat satellite imagery and Sentinel in 1999, 2004, 2009, 2014, and 2019. Image processing is done with the support of ER Mapper 7,0, Arc GIS 10,2,2, The method of determining land for mangrove rehabilitation includes the physical conditions of the waters and the analysis of the sediment’s grain size. Adjustment area of abrasion in Kaliwlingi, Brebes Regency from 1999 to 2019 were 121,42ha, 109,32ha, 102,98ha and 151,57ha, respectively, Meanwhile, there are 4 points of emerge land found in the research location, With the units of abrasion value in Kaliwlingi, Brebes Regency and emerge land can be used as mangrove rehabilitation area.
